About

Madhuri Garg is a scholar working on Cell Biology, Immunology and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Madhuri Garg has authored 6 papers receiving a total of 304 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 3 papers in Cell Biology, 3 papers in Immunology and 2 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Madhuri Garg's work include melanin and skin pigmentation (3 papers), Atherosclerosis and Cardiovascular Diseases (3 papers) and T-cell and B-cell Immunology (2 papers). Madhuri Garg is often cited by papers focused on melanin and skin pigmentation (3 papers), Atherosclerosis and Cardiovascular Diseases (3 papers) and T-cell and B-cell Immunology (2 papers). Madhuri Garg collaborates with scholars based in United States, India and Nepal. Madhuri Garg's co-authors include Jillian M. Richmond, James P. Strassner, John E. Harris, Xueli Fan, Rebecca L. Riding, J. Yun Tso, Andrea Tovar‐Garza, Naoya Tsurushita, Amit G. Pandya and Lucio Zapata and has published in prestigious journals such as Science Translational Medicine, Journal of Investigative Dermatology and Annals of Cardiac Anaesthesia.
